32with Interfaces.C; use Interfaces.C;
33
34package body Ada.Calendar.Conversions is
35
36   -----------------
37   -- To_Ada_Time --
38   -----------------
39
40   function To_Ada_Time (Unix_Time : long) return Time is
41      Val : constant Long_Integer := Long_Integer (Unix_Time);
42   begin
43      return Conversion_Operations.To_Ada_Time (Val);
44   end To_Ada_Time;
45
46   -----------------
47   -- To_Ada_Time --
48   -----------------
49
50   function To_Ada_Time
51     (tm_year  : int;
52      tm_mon   : int;
53      tm_day   : int;
54      tm_hour  : int;
55      tm_min   : int;
56      tm_sec   : int;
57      tm_isdst : int) return Time
58   is
59      Year   : constant Integer := Integer (tm_year);
60      Month  : constant Integer := Integer (tm_mon);
61      Day    : constant Integer := Integer (tm_day);
62      Hour   : constant Integer := Integer (tm_hour);
63      Minute : constant Integer := Integer (tm_min);
64      Second : constant Integer := Integer (tm_sec);
65      DST    : constant Integer := Integer (tm_isdst);
66   begin
67      return
68        Conversion_Operations.To_Ada_Time
69          (Year, Month, Day, Hour, Minute, Second, DST);
70   end To_Ada_Time;
71
72   -----------------
73   -- To_Duration --
74   -----------------
75
76   function To_Duration
77     (tv_sec  : long;
78      tv_nsec : long) return Duration
79   is
80      Secs      : constant Long_Integer := Long_Integer (tv_sec);
81      Nano_Secs : constant Long_Integer := Long_Integer (tv_nsec);
82   begin
83      return Conversion_Operations.To_Duration (Secs, Nano_Secs);
84   end To_Duration;
85
86   ------------------------
87   -- To_Struct_Timespec --
88   ------------------------
89
90   procedure To_Struct_Timespec
91     (D       : Duration;
92      tv_sec  : out long;
93      tv_nsec : out long)
94   is
95      Secs      : Long_Integer;
96      Nano_Secs : Long_Integer;
97
98   begin
99      Conversion_Operations.To_Struct_Timespec (D, Secs, Nano_Secs);
100
101      tv_sec  := long (Secs);
102      tv_nsec := long (Nano_Secs);
103   end To_Struct_Timespec;
104
105   ------------------
106   -- To_Struct_Tm --
107   ------------------
108
109   procedure To_Struct_Tm
110     (T       : Time;
111      tm_year : out int;
112      tm_mon  : out int;
113      tm_day  : out int;
114      tm_hour : out int;
115      tm_min  : out int;
116      tm_sec  : out int)
117   is
118      Year   : Integer;
119      Month  : Integer;
120      Day    : Integer;
121      Hour   : Integer;
122      Minute : Integer;
123      Second : Integer;
124
125   begin
126      Conversion_Operations.To_Struct_Tm
127        (T, Year, Month, Day, Hour, Minute, Second);
128
129      tm_year := int (Year);
130      tm_mon  := int (Month);
131      tm_day  := int (Day);
132      tm_hour := int (Hour);
133      tm_min  := int (Minute);
134      tm_sec  := int (Second);
135   end To_Struct_Tm;
136
137   ------------------
138   -- To_Unix_Time --
139   ------------------
140
141   function To_Unix_Time (Ada_Time : Time) return long is
142      Val : constant Long_Integer :=
143        Conversion_Operations.To_Unix_Time (Ada_Time);
144   begin
145      return long (Val);
146   end To_Unix_Time;
147
148end Ada.Calendar.Conversions;
